Datachump,

The preference for EGL-LA is mostly old news. The LA lab used to be operated by a different company entirely and they enjoyed a very good reputation. There was a messy court battle that resulted in EGL-USA taking over the operations in LA and the other company is now running PGS in Chicago (which is a good lab by the way). I''ve found EGL-USA to be pretty consistent across their several labs, including the ones in Canada. I don''t think it matters which location graded your stones.
